Project Overview: Bechtel has been providing program, project, and construction management services for Riverside County Transportation Commission (RCTC) for the past 36 years. The project team helps RCTC to implement "Measure A", the Regional Transportation Plan (RTP) / Sustainable Communities Strategy (SCS) and adopted plans and programs in compliance with state and federal requirements with the goal of providing the residents of Riverside County greater mobility, improved quality of life, operational excellence, and economic vitality. Today, our colleagues' team with customers, partners, and suppliers on diverse projects in nearly 40 countries. Bechtel is seeking an Associate Project Manager to join the Riverside, California team. This team oversees the planning, environmental clearance, design, and construction of projects on the state highway system, under California Department of Transportation (Caltrans) oversight and following Caltrans' standards and procedures, and on commuter and freight rail lines, under Federal Transit Administration (FTA), Southern California Regional Rail Authority (SCRRA) or Burlington Northern Santa Fe Railroad (BNSF), and Union Pacific Railroad (UP) oversight and following their standards.
